GW Views on Death on the 208th Anniversary of His Passing: December 14

“The will of Heaven is not to be controverted or scrutinized by the children of this world. It therefore becomes the Creatures
of it to submit with patience and resignation to the will of the
Creator whether it be to prolong, or to shorten the number
of our days.”

Source: Letter to George Augustine Washington, January 27, 1793
